Achieving enterprise-level sales volume in your retail business is a remarkable achievement. It shows you’ve increased product sales and developed a reputation as a reliable business in your industry. With this come newfound logistical challenges.
As your business scales, you’ll need a robust order management system (OMS) to efficiently handle incoming products from suppliers and outgoing shipments to customers. For B2B sellers, a smooth order management process is crucial to meeting expectations and delivering a positive customer experience.
Business-to-business (B2B) sellers turn to an OMS to handle inventory management and order fulfillment processes. If you need one, it’s wise to understand how they work and which features to prioritize. Let’s take a look at how to choose the best B2B order management platform for your business.
What is B2B order management software?
B2B order management software helps sellers process and track orders placed by other businesses. When a B2B order is placed, the software tracks every step of the order process, from capturing purchase details to checking stock levels and coordinating warehouse shipments. This technology reduces human error and keeps buyers happy by connecting all parts of the ordering process in one seamless system.
Types of B2B order management software
B2B order management software takes three forms:
- Traditional order management software
- Enterprise resource planning (ERP) software
- Unified commerce platforms
Here’s how they differ:
1. Traditional order management software
Traditional order management software focuses solely on processing orders and inventory across multiple channels, and comes with an affordable price but limited integration capabilities. It lets you accept orders from multiple places, like your website, physical stores, and online marketplaces like Alibaba where B2B buyers and sellers connect.
Once orders come in, this software manages the fulfillment process by tracking inventory, creating packing slips, coordinating with shipping companies, and updating delivery status.
Benefits:
- Affordable for businesses of all sizes with various pricing options
- Straightforward to set up and implement
- Handles multiple sales channels efficiently
Drawbacks
- Limited integration with other business systems
- May require manual data entry in multiple systems
- May not scale well as business complexity increases
2. Enterprise resource planning (ERP) software
Enterprise resource planning (ERP) software provides comprehensive integration of all business functions and data in one system, but requires an investment in cost, time, and resources. It aggregates data from product design, inventory, customer relationship management (CRM), sales, and marketing.
With ERP software, your sales team can look up how much inventory remains in your warehouses, and your customer service team can find past purchase orders and delivery confirmations.
Many businesses manage their electronic data interchange (EDI) connections through their ERP system. EDI is a standardized digital format primarily used for exchanging business documents like purchase orders, invoices, and shipping notices with suppliers and trading partners.
ERP software can be expensive, and large companies often opt for a complete ERP ecommerce integration.
Benefits:
- Provides a complete, integrated view of all business operations
- Eliminates data silos between departments
- Offers real-time visibility across all business processes
- Automates data flow between different business functions
Drawbacks:
- Expensive to purchase and implement
- Complex setup requiring months of configuration and training
- Often requires business process changes to accommodate the software
- Typically practical only for larger companies
- Requires significant IT resources to maintain
3. Unified commerce platforms
Unified commerce platforms like Shopify offer a complete solution that seamlessly integrates B2B and retail operations in one system, simplifying data management and providing specialized features for each business model.
Shopify captures purchase details, manages inventory updates, processes payments, coordinates shipping, and handles returns. Businesses using B2B on Shopify see up to a 1.2x increase in reorder frequency compared to those using alternative methods of B2B selling on our platform.
Shopify uses a common data model that can be configured to handle both B2B and retail transactions. If you want to integrate inventory, customer data, and orders, Shopify can sync the data automatically across wholesale and retail operations. Alternatively, businesses requiring separate inventory management for B2B and DTC can set up dedicated stores with customized configurations, a popular choice for retailers selling more than two million dollars in B2B volume.
Having all your sales data in one place makes reporting easier. You can create reports that show just B2B sales, just retail sales, or everything together. You can also track products from warehouse to delivery more easily, see exactly what's in stock, and manage shipping from one dashboard.
For example, The Conran Shop switched from Magento (Adobe Commerce) to Shopify and brought their retail and wholesale businesses together. This cut their costs by 50%, increased sales conversions by 54%, and made their whole order process simpler while still keeping the special features they needed for wholesale.
Benefits:
- Combines B2B and retail operations in a single platform
- Flexible configuration for either integrated or separate inventory management
- Centralized data makes reporting and analysis more straightforward
- More affordable than full ERP systems while offering many similar features
- Easier implementation and shorter learning curve
- Provides end-to-end order visibility from placement to delivery
Drawbacks:
- Might require add-ons or integrations for complex B2B requirements
Key features of B2B order management software
Order management software can optimize your workflows to meet the needs of B2B buyers. Here are five features frequently included with order management software platforms:
1. Order confirmation
Order management software can send automatic confirmations to customers and the seller’s sales team after a purchase. These confirmations may include order numbers, estimated shipping costs, and any sales tax due.
2. Shipping confirmation
Order management software can send a shipment notification to a customer. It can also inform you, the seller, when your products leave your warehouse (or a dropshipper’s warehouse).
3. Order tracking
Order management platforms can fetch shipping data from delivery services like USPS, FedEx, and UPS and display shipping updates from third-party websites. This lets customers track orders from your website rather than an outside site. They can easily check their order status and receive timely notifications.
4. Price management
Order management software makes sure your B2B customers see their negotiated prices everywhere on your site. When wholesale clients log in, they'll see their specific contract prices on all pages, from search results to product pages to checkout. This keeps pricing consistent even when you update your base prices.
The software handles different price levels for different customers, so each business client sees exactly what they should pay. It’s a good way to make purchasing easier for your B2B customers, and prevent pricing mistakes that can harm relationships.
5. Supply chain management
Some order management software can help you track items shipped from suppliers. It provides inventory data, and can even automate procurement so products are automatically reordered when supplies dip below a specific threshold. This includes proper allocation, to guarantee you always have the right stock in the right location to prevent back-order issues.
Five factors to consider when choosing B2B order management software
As you research order management software for your B2B sales platforms, you’ll find many options with various prices and features. Streamline your search by focusing on these five key factors:
1. Integration with other software
The best order management software easily integrates with your current software tools, including accounting software for financial management and customer relationship management (CRM) software used for managing customer data.
If you choose enterprise resource planning (ERP) software, you opt for a system that integrates all your software applications and databases. ERP systems can cost hundreds of thousands of dollars, though they can provide cost savings over the lifetime of your business.
2. Ease of use
Order management software is only helpful if your team members know how to use it. Your IT department might oversee its initial integration, but everyone in your organization must be able to use it. This means sales reps can look up order data for their customers and warehouse managers can monitor inventory levels. Choose software everyone on your team can learn quickly.
3. Scalability
Your OMS must be able to scale as your business grows. A truly scalable system includes:
- Modular architecture that allows you to add new features without disrupting existing operations
- Cloud-based infrastructure that can automatically allocate more resources during order surges
- Easy integration with new sales channels or third-party services
Flexibility is essential. This means your OMS should adapt to changing business models—whether you're expanding from online-only to physical stores, entering new markets, or accommodating seasonal demand fluctuations.
The right OMS provides this adaptability without requiring a complete system replacement, saving you significant time and resources as your business evolves.
4. Range of capabilities
The features you need from your OMS depend on the nature of your business. If you work with dropshippers, you may only need an OMS to process customer orders. If you ship your own products, you need order management software that handles the logistics behind every purchase order, from shipping to inventory management.
Your business will require features like negotiated pricing, which shows a range of prices to users based on their customer profile and the time of purchase. You may need to offer wholesale pricing as well as retail, or different shipping options, such as USPS for standard delivery and FedEx for same day delivery.
Taking time to think about what your business really needs will help you pick an OMS that works well now and as you grow.
5. Price
Order management software prices vary based on the features, the number of users, and the number of orders it processes each month. Many platforms offer tiered pricing, which allows you to match your software subscription to the size of your business. This software is typically sold on a monthly subscription basis. Consider choosing the most robust software suite you can afford and upgrading over time.
Top five B2B order management software
Order management software can enable smoother business operations and help increase customer satisfaction. Here are five B2B order management software options worth considering:
1. Shopify
Shopify is a unified commerce solution that can optimize your B2B and business-to-consumer (B2C) order management. Among its many functions, Shopify can power your checkout (online and in person), order processing, email confirmations, fulfillment, and follow-up customer service.
With Shopify as your OMS, you can automate the entire order lifecycle with automated workflows, centralize inventory management across channels, and access order tracking capabilities. The platform supports complex order workflows, including order modifications, back orders, and partial fulfillments.
B2B on Shopify offers custom company profiles that handle multiple buyers and locations with different access levels, giving each B2B customer a personalized experience. You can set up wholesale accounts with tailored product catalogs, pricing, order quantities, volume discounts, payment terms, and self-service options. This helps businesses create complete buying experiences while making operations more efficient with easy bulk-ordering and account management tools.
Shopify integrates with a variety of third-party tools like ERPs, email marketing platforms, and customer relationship management systems, with these integrations available in the Shopify App Store.
You can use Shopify to import B2B orders from non-Shopify platforms, centralizing all your order data in a single, intuitive admin experience that allows teams to create and analyze reports easily. Shopify also provides B2B customers with a complete self-serve buying experience where they can place their own orders, manage their accounts, and review and track order history within your online store.
The Shopify Plus plan starts at $2,300 a month for standard setups and integrations on a three-year term, or $2,500 per month for a one-year term.
2. Cin7 Omni
Cin7 Omni is a multichannel order and inventory management system. Its features include inventory and warehouse management, retail operations and point-of-sale (POS) services, invoicing, payments, and shipping logistics. Its pricing tiers start at $999 per month and can accommodate any business from a simple B2C ecommerce operation up to a multinational distribution service.
3. Brightpearl
Brightpearl by Sage is a retail operating system. It includes the signature features of B2B order management software, including inventory and order management, shipping and fulfillment, warehouse management, and CRM tools. It integrates with many third-party sales platforms, including Shopify, and offers customer service to help you get maximum value from your subscription. Contact Brightpearl for a price quote.
4. Pipe17
Pipe17 is an integration platform for businesses managing both B2B and DTC sales channels, connecting Shopify with ERPs, marketplaces, and fulfillment centers. It automatically syncs inventory, routes orders, and manages data flow between all connected systems in real time through a user-friendly dashboard.
The software handles complex operations like order splitting, kit management, and multi-location fulfillment without requiring technical expertise. At $24,000 per year for the standard plan, it's positioned for midmarket and enterprise sellers processing up to 4,000 orders monthly across up to five connected platforms.
5. SparkLayer
SparkLayer is a B2B wholesale solution that turns existing Shopify stores into wholesale websites, offering customer-specific pricing, quotes, invoicing, and team collaboration. It provides tiered pricing starting at $49 per month for up to 50 orders, with free onboarding services and customer support rated 4.9 out of 5 by Shopify App store users.
The platform allows both customers and sales representatives to easily place orders, integrates seamlessly with existing Shopify themes, and supports multi-language and multi-currency for international businesses.
Benefits of a B2B order management system
Increase efficiency
A B2B OMS helps your business work smarter and faster by cutting out unnecessary steps and putting all your information in one place. It automates routine tasks, creates consistent processes, and grows with your business so your team can handle more orders without hiring more people.
Here are some key ways it makes your team more efficient:
- Shows your inventory levels across all sales channels in real time
- Speeds up order approvals so orders don't get stuck waiting for signatures
- Makes payment processing faster and easier to track
- Lets customers place orders and check status themselves without calling you
- Replaces paper forms with digital records that are easy to find
- Processes many orders at once instead of one at a time
With these efficiency improvements, your team can focus on serving high-value wholesale accounts, negotiating better supplier terms, and expanding your distribution network instead of getting bogged down in manual order processing.
Improve cash flow
When your order data lives in one system, you get real-time visibility into metrics like order values, payment status, and customer credit limits. It enables more accurate cash flow forecasting and helps identify high-margin customer segments. You can also track payment behaviors across your B2B customer base to refine credit policies and reduce days sales outstanding (DSO).
Automate complex supply chain processes
A B2B order management system automatically routes orders to the right fulfillment centers based on inventory levels, customer location, and delivery requirements.
Less manual coordination between procurement, warehouse, and finance results in higher operational efficiency. You'll have better visibility into inventory costs and can optimize working capital by maintaining appropriate stock levels.
Manage your B2B and wholesale orders with Shopify
Whether you're dealing with B2B buyers directly or collaborating with distributors, you need a solution that centralizes sales orders, tracks shipments, and improves operational efficiency.
Without this centralization, wholesale businesses struggle with order errors, inventory discrepancies, and inefficient manual processes that limit growth. Grow and run your wholesale business on Shopify with tools optimized for flexibility and customization, for all your buyers.
Explore how to run and grow your B2B business on Shopify.
B2B order management software FAQ
What is the difference between OMS and CRM?
CRM stands for customer relationship management. CRM software focuses on relationships with existing and potential customers, tracking everything from demographic data to order history. Order management software specifically addresses the logistics surrounding purchase orders.
Can B2B order management software integrate with existing ERP and CRM systems?
Yes, the best B2B order management software can integrate with many other software platforms, including ERP and CRM systems.
How secure is B2B order management software in terms of data protection and privacy?
Most B2B order management software platforms have multiple levels of data protection, including encrypted servers and two-factor authentication upon login. Train your teams in best practices for customer privacy and data management.
Is B2B order management software scalable to accommodate business growth?
Yes, nearly all B2B order management platforms are scalable and allow you to upgrade to higher tiers as your company reaches enterprise-level order volumes.